Decoding Your Laptop’s Video Output Options
So, what’s actually on your laptop? You’ve got a few main contenders, and knowing them is half the battle. Most laptops made in the last decade will have an HDMI port. It’s the ubiquitous one you see on TVs, gaming consoles, pretty much everywhere. It carries both video and audio, which is handy.
Then there’s DisplayPort. Often seen as the more professional or gamer-oriented option, it tends to support higher refresh rates and resolutions more easily than HDMI, though HDMI has caught up significantly. DisplayPort often looks a bit like HDMI but with one angled corner, making it harder to plug in upside down.
USB-C is the new kid on the block, and it’s a beast. A single USB-C port can often do a multitude of things: data transfer, power delivery, and video output (via DisplayPort Alternate Mode or Thunderbolt). This is where things can get confusing because not all USB-C ports are created equal. If your USB-C port has a little lightning bolt symbol next to it, it’s Thunderbolt, which is the most capable version and definitely supports video. If it has a ‘DP’ symbol, it supports DisplayPort over USB-C. If it has neither, it *might* still support video, but it’s a gamble.

HDMI: The Universal Connector (mostly)
HDMI (High-Definition Multimedia Interface) is probably what most people think of first. It’s been around for ages, and chances are good your monitor has at least one HDMI port. The cable has a distinctive trapezoidal shape, and it’s keyed so you can only plug it in one way. It’s a solid, reliable choice for most general-purpose use.
Audio and video over one cable is a big win. You don’t need a separate audio cable, which simplifies things considerably. It’s the workhorse of display connectivity.
Displayport: For the Enthusiasts and Professionals
DisplayPort is often preferred by PC gamers and professionals who need high refresh rates and resolutions. It’s designed with monitors in mind. While it also carries audio, its primary advantage lies in its ability to handle more demanding visual signals. Think buttery-smooth frame rates and incredibly sharp images.
The connector itself is a bit more robust than HDMI, often featuring a locking mechanism that prevents it from accidentally becoming unplugged, which is a lifesaver during intense gaming sessions or when you’re leaning over your desk a lot.
USB-C: The Versatile Powerhouse
USB-C is where things get really interesting, and potentially confusing. A single USB-C port can handle so much. If your laptop supports DisplayPort Alternate Mode (often abbreviated as DP Alt Mode) or Thunderbolt, then a USB-C cable can absolutely drive your external monitor. This is fantastic for thin and light laptops that might not have dedicated HDMI or DisplayPort, offering a single cable solution for docking stations, charging, and external displays.
But here’s the catch: not all USB-C ports are created equal. Some are just for charging and data. Some support video. You have to check your laptop’s specifications, or look for those little symbols next to the port. I’ve seen people buy USB-C to HDMI adapters only to find out their laptop’s USB-C port doesn’t actually output video. It’s a surprisingly common mistake, costing people time and money. A quick check of your laptop manual or manufacturer’s website is usually enough to clarify this. According to tech documentation from major manufacturers like Dell and HP, the presence of specific logos (like a lightning bolt for Thunderbolt or ‘DP’ for DisplayPort) is the clearest indicator of video output capability over USB-C.
The Cable Itself: More Than Just Wires
Once you’ve identified your ports, the cable becomes the next puzzle piece. For HDMI and DisplayPort, you’ll need a cable with the corresponding connectors on both ends. So, if your laptop has HDMI out and your monitor has HDMI in, you need an HDMI-to-HDMI cable. Simple enough.
If you’re using USB-C for video, you might need a USB-C to USB-C cable (if your monitor also has USB-C input), or a USB-C to HDMI/DisplayPort adapter or cable, depending on your monitor’s available ports. Adapters can be finicky sometimes. Some are great, others are… less so. Cheap adapters often use older chipsets that don’t support higher resolutions or refresh rates properly, leading to flickering or a blurry image. It’s like buying the cheapest engine part you can find for a sports car; it might work for a bit, but you’re asking for trouble down the line. I spent around $70 testing three different USB-C to HDMI adapters before finding one that reliably pushed 4K at 60Hz without dropping frames.
The cable’s specifications matter. For 4K resolution, you need a cable that supports at least HDMI 2.0 or DisplayPort 1.2. For higher refresh rates (like 120Hz or 144Hz), you’ll need even newer standards like HDMI 2.1 or DisplayPort 1.4. Buying a cable labeled simply ‘High Speed’ might not be enough for your fancy new setup. It’s like expecting a garden hose to put out a skyscraper fire; it’s just not built for that kind of demand. Looking closely at the cable itself, especially for DisplayPort, you might see markings indicating its version. HDMI cables are usually marked with their speed category (Standard, High Speed, Premium High Speed, Ultra High Speed). Always go for the highest spec you can afford that matches your intended use. It’s an investment in a smooth experience.
Troubleshooting: When the Screen Stays Dark
So, you’ve got the right ports, the right cable, and you’ve plugged everything in. Yet, still no picture. Don’t panic. This is where the real fun (or frustration) begins. First, double-check that the cable is firmly seated at both ends. Sometimes it feels plugged in, but it’s just not quite making the connection. Give it a firm push.
Next, check your monitor’s input source. Most monitors have multiple inputs (HDMI 1, HDMI 2, DisplayPort, etc.). You need to make sure the monitor is set to the correct input for the cable you’re using. Use your monitor’s physical buttons or on-screen menu to cycle through the inputs until you find the one that’s receiving the signal. This sounds obvious, but I’ve definitely spent ten minutes convinced my hardware was fried, only to realize I was on the wrong input setting.
If that doesn’t work, try a different cable. As I mentioned, cables can fail. Sometimes the internal wires break, or the connectors get damaged. If you have another cable of the same type, swap it out. If you don’t, and you suspect the cable, it might be worth borrowing one from a friend or picking up a cheap one from a local store just to test. This is a much better approach than immediately buying a new, expensive monitor or laptop.
Restart your devices. Turn off your laptop and your monitor completely. Unplug them both from the power outlet for about 30 seconds. Then, plug them back in and turn them on, starting with the monitor, then the laptop. Sometimes a simple power cycle can clear up a stubborn communication issue. It’s the tech equivalent of taking a deep breath and starting over.
Finally, if you’re using a docking station or adapter, try connecting the laptop directly to the monitor. This helps you isolate whether the issue lies with the adapter/dock or with the laptop/monitor connection itself. Seven out of ten times I’ve had a display issue with a dock, the dock itself was the culprit. They are convenient, but they add another layer of potential failure points.
What If My Laptop Doesn’t Have the Right Port?
This is where adapters and docking stations come in. If your laptop only has USB-C and your monitor only has HDMI, you’ll need a USB-C to HDMI adapter or cable. If your laptop is older and only has USB-A ports (the rectangular ones) and your monitor has HDMI, you might be out of luck for direct digital video output unless you use a specific USB-to-video adapter, which can sometimes be laggy. For older laptops, your best bet is often an external graphics card that connects via USB, but that’s a whole other can of worms and usually not worth the cost unless you absolutely need it.
For most people, if their laptop is missing a direct video out port they need, a USB-C adapter is the way to go. Just be sure that USB-C port actually supports video output, as we discussed. People Also Ask:
What Is the Cable Called That Goes From a Laptop to a Monitor?
That cable is typically an HDMI cable, a DisplayPort cable, or a USB-C cable (if your laptop and monitor support video output over USB-C). The specific name depends on the type of port on your laptop and monitor.
Can I Connect My Laptop to a Monitor with a USB-C Cable?
Yes, you can, but only if both your laptop’s USB-C port and your monitor’s USB-C port support video output (often through DisplayPort Alternate Mode or Thunderbolt). Not all USB-C ports have this capability.
What Is the Difference Between HDMI and Displayport?
HDMI is more common and carries audio and video, while DisplayPort is often preferred for higher refresh rates and resolutions, particularly in gaming and professional settings. DisplayPort also has a more robust locking connector.
Do I Need a Special Cable to Connect My Laptop to a Monitor?
You need a cable that matches the ports on both your laptop and monitor (e.g., HDMI to HDMI). For higher resolutions or refresh rates, you’ll need a cable that supports those specifications (e.g., HDMI 2.0/2.1 or DisplayPort 1.2/1.4).
